Wanted hijacker arrested with police firearm, Giyani

Jeffrey Chabalala (25) was remanded in custody when he appeared at the Giyani Magistrate’s Court on Monday, 18 December 2017.

Chabalala has been on the police’s wanted list for a spate of car hijackings in and around Giyani.

Chabalala was arrested on Friday, 15 December 2017 between Hlaneki and Mashavele villages when the police reacted to a tip off from a community member who informed them about a man who was in possession of a firearm.

When the police pounced on the suspect he was found to be the one they were pursuing for some time.

A police firearm with the serial number filed off was found in possession of the suspect. Chabalala has already been positively linked with at least two cases of car hijacking, one during which a firearm was used.

Investigations are underway to establish how Chabalala got hold of the state firearm.

The Cluster Commander of Giyani Major General Mbhazima Ngobeni thanked the community for their continued cooperation and working together with the police.

“This is what we mean by true partnership in the fight against crime. We need the community members to provide us with information and our police must always be of assistance”, Major General Ngobeni said.
